The Other Self
As night falls, we return to our home.
The tranquil of the night calls forth the unseen.
The soul departs from its chamber,
Encountering the mysteries of the hidden world.
At times, it finds a vast meadow of shadows;
At other times, it meets the other self that veils the daylight self.
